Transaction 97256dcfa6a3e95e2fc39ff472c86a1ebed16c5c266ca21b2dade3346f0a644e
1 Input
1 Output
-
97256dcfa6a3e95e2fc39ff472c86a1ebed16c5c266ca21b2dade3346f0a644e:0
- value
- 19842550
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1fb6587c74d39d1d59d92823c4391df3de3bf71814fec96523dee491b0c42c43
- address
- bc1pr7m9slr56ww36kwe9q3ugwga700rhaccznlvjefrmmjfrvxy93psswx8fm